What Permits Do I Need to Lease an Event Space in London Covent Garden Henrietta Street?

To lease an event space in London Covent Garden Henrietta Street, procuring a temporary occupation permit is essential. Applications should be filed 3-6 weeks ahead. If serving alcohol, obtain a Temporary Event Notice (TEN). Failing to secure the right permits can result in liabilities or being unable to host the event. What Factors Affect the Cost of Booking an Event Space in London Covent Garden Henrietta Street?

The cost of booking an event space in London Covent Garden Henrietta Street depends on location, size, and season. Key influences include the proximity to landmarks like the Royal Opera House, the type and size of the space, and peak demand driven by events such as the London Film Festival.

  1. Location: Spaces near iconic spots like Henrietta Street demand higher prices.
  2. Size: Larger venues naturally incur more costs.
  3. Season: Events during the London Film Festival see increased demand and prices.

Entry-level event spaces in London Covent Garden Henrietta Street typically start from £500 per day. Mid-range options range from £800 to £1,500. Premium locations on or near Henrietta Street can reach £2,000 or more during the London Film Festival. Setup costs can add from £200 to £500 depending on scope and duration.

What Is Included in the Price of a Short-Term Hire in London Covent Garden Henrietta Street?

The price of a short-term hire in London Covent Garden Henrietta Street often includes basic amenities and utilities. Essentials such as Wi-Fi, lighting, and heating are typically covered. Additional services like security, cleaning, and AV equipment may require extra fees.

  1. Basic Amenities: Wi-Fi, lighting, and heating are generally included.
  2. Venue Services: Security and cleaning might incur additional costs.
  3. Equipment Rental: AV and other tech may not be covered.

It's crucial to clarify the specifics with your provider to avoid unexpected expenses and ensure all event requirements are met.
